FEATURES
Very low operating power:
12 µA typical per amplifier
High output sink/source capability
Supply Voltage Range 1.8 to 5.5V
Rail-to-Rail Output Swing

DESCRIPTION
The DS4802 BiCMOS dual operational amplifier combines low input offset voltage, very low power
consumption, rail-to-rail output swing, and excellent DC precision. With a maximum input offset voltage
of 0.95 mV, a maximum IDD of 25 µA/amplifier, and 10 pA typical input bias current, the DS4802 is ideal
for measurement, medical, and industrial applications. The DS4802 is also ideal for portable applications
with 1.8 volt to 5.5 volt single supply voltage operation and low power consumption.
